Artificial Intelligence is rapidly becoming an integral part of various digital technologies including software and many aspects of ICT infrastructure. For example, the AI chipset marketplace is poised to transform the entire embedded system ecosystem with a multitude of AI capabilities such as deep machine learning, image detection, and many others. With 85% of all chipsets globally shipping AI-equipped, over 63% of all electronics will have some form of embedded intelligence by 2026. The AI in next generation networking market as a whole will ultimately be much larger as infrastructure vendors embed AI within virtually all software and platforms.

Infrastructure is anticipated to be one of the primary focus areas for AI as network operators seek to reduce costs and improve efficiencies while simultaneously reducing the incidence of errors and adverse network events. AI technology will play a key role in the transformation of network intelligence to become increasingly self-driven. Technologies like cognitive computing, machine learning, deep learning, and predictive application will be fundamental to the transformation of network configuration automation and operational autonomy.

AI-driven networking is going to impact wireless networking of all sizes for all communication service providers, improving service realization and support, and ultimately impacting every industry vertical from transportation to medical care to financial services. Furthermore, we see the convergence of AI and Internet of Things (IoT) technologies and solutions (AIoT) leading to "thinking" networks and systems that are becoming increasingly more capable of solving a wide range of problems across a diverse number of industry verticals.

In terms of the impact of AI on wireless networks, the evolution is already underway from a standards and network topology approach with 5G service-based architectures. Implementation within public communications service providers will scale slowly due to legacy systems such as OSS/BSS. However, closed-loop private 5G wireless networks will be in the vanguard of deployment for AI next generation networking.

This evolution will lead to AI-enabled functions throughout 6G networks within the 2030 to 2040 timeframe. This will include contextually agile RF networks that support event-driven adaptation and resource allocation optimization. It will also include many improvements at the device level such as AI-enabled distributed computing, which will facilitate persistent computation-oriented communications.
